Debt-ridden farmer commits suicide in Madhya Pradesh, 46 deaths reported in a month

Khargone (Madhya Pradesh): Another farmer committed suicide due to debt in Madhya Pradesh, this time in Khargone district, taking the total number of such farmer deaths to 46 in 31 days. Taake Singh, 50, drank insecticide and died on Tuesday night. According to information received from Bhikangaon police station, the farmer, a resident of Anjangaon village, died at the government hospital in Khargone. He was admitted to the government hospital after his health deteriorated and he died on Tuesday night. His relatives say that Taake Singh was disturbed as his chilli crop had been destroyed and he was also under debt, and that is why he drank the pesticide. Ajeet Singh, officer in-charge of Bhikangaon police station, said police is investigating the matter and the reason for suicide will be known only after the probe is complete.
